Output 26057efea596a41395ded3cef4aaaf812bea06160020a70c5d158fec2d9ccc3e:1

value
2894004927
script pubkey
OP_0 OP_PUSHBYTES_20 109f9089969767391960c943768b97b590688b62
address
ltc1qzz0epzvkjannjxtqe9phdzuhkkgx3zmzaq9828
transaction
26057efea596a41395ded3cef4aaaf812bea06160020a70c5d158fec2d9ccc3e
spent
true